4images Forum & Community
International => Turkish / Türkçe => Topic started by: suvarimx on April 26, 2008, 04:41:30 PM
-
Arkadaşlar malumunuz scriptin anahtar kelimeleri ile bulunan sonuçlardan yönlenen sayfalar www.siteniz.com/img2913.search.htm şeklinde oluyor.
Yani normalde www.siteniz.com/img2913.htm şeklinde var olan bir sayfa farklı bir adresle tekrar karşımıza çıkıyor.
Bunu nasıl değiştirebiliriz?
-
evet sorun çözülebilir ama nasıl? :)
Nasıl yapılacağı hakkında hiçbir fikrim yok, bilen bir arkadaş el atıp burada paylaşırsa çok memnun olurum.
-
arkadaşlar bu scriptle birlkte geken bir özellik. Yani benim .htacces ile ilgili bir düzenlememden kaynaklanmıyor ama yinede buraya koyuyorum:
# Begin search engine friendly links code
RewriteEngine On
#RewriteBase /
RewriteRule ^lightbox\.htm$ lightbox.php?%{QUERY_STRING}
RewriteRule ^lightbox\.([0-9]+)\.htm$ lightbox.php?page=$1&%{QUERY_STRING}
RewriteRule ^search\.htm$ search.php?%{QUERY_STRING}
RewriteRule ^search\.([0-9]+)\.htm$ search.php?page=$1&%{QUERY_STRING}
RewriteRule ^cat\.htm$ categories.php?%{QUERY_STRING}
RewriteRule ^cat([0-9]+)\.([0-9]+)\.htm$ categories.php?cat_id=$1&page=$2&%{QUERY_STRING}
RewriteRule ^cat([0-9]+)\.htm$ categories.php?cat_id=$1&%{QUERY_STRING}
RewriteRule ^img([0-9]+)\.htm$ details.php?image_id=$1&%{QUERY_STRING}
RewriteRule ^img([0-9]+)\.([a-zA-Z0-9]+)\.htm$ details.php?image_id=$1&mode=$2&%{QUERY_STRING}
RewriteRule ^postcard([a-zA-Z0-9]+)\.htm$ postcards.php?postcard_id=$1&%{QUERY_STRING}
RewriteRule ^postcard\.img([0-9]+)\.htm$ postcards.php?image_id=$1&%{QUERY_STRING}
RewriteRule ^sitemap.xml$ google.php
# End search engine friendly links code
-
malesef her iki durumda da değişme olmadı :(
iki şekilde de yine
http://www.sitem.com/img1076.htm olan sayfalarımın
http://www.sitem.com/img1076.search.htm diye ikizleri mevcut oluyor.
.search kısmını yok edebilirsek linklerden sorun kalkacak sanırım.
-
asıl siz kusura bakmayın yoruyoruz sizi:)
-
malesef:( bunu bende denemiştim ama yine olmadı..
bu search niye bla oldu bize yav:)
-
aslina bakarsaniz ben tam olarak sorunu anlamadim. Gerci cozum bulacagini sanmiyorum ama (okadar php bilgim yok) yinede hepimizi ilgilendirien sorun sanirim.
-
PHP uzmanı arkadaşlar bir el atsalar süper olacak ama neyse çokta önemli bir sorun değil zaten. Sadece kafama takılmıştı o kısım. Yinede teşekkürler herkese. :wink:
-
Neden böyle bir değişim istiyorsunuz ki? Bu şekilde sayfanız google'da daha fazla listelenmiş olacaktır. Zaten 4images'in en güzel özelliklerinden bir tanesi de bu. Bir tane resim ekliyorsunuz 5-6 sayfanız indexleniyor.
-
bu benimde başıma dert olan bir sorundu ama kendimce bi çözüm buldum
imgxxx.search.htm şeklinde çıkmasını engelleyemedim fakat .htaccess dosyasına aşağıdaki satırı ekleyerek sorunu hallettim
RewriteRule ^img([0-9]+).search.htm details.php?image_id=$1&%{QUERY_STRING}
ayrıca aynı sorun lightboxta da çıkıyor istersen bunu da ekle
RewriteRule ^img([0-9]+).lightbox.htm details.php?image_id=$1&%{QUERY_STRING}